During my staycation in Manila, my temporary home was the Waterfront Pavilion Hotel and Casino Manila (hotel info). It is conveniently located near Intramuros and the famous Rizal Park.

It used to be called Manila Hilton Hotel and built in 1968; it is also famous for being the first tallest five-star hotel during those times. It became a part of the prominent chain of hotels of Waterfront Philippines and underwent several renovations and redesigning by world-renowned interior designer Sonia Santiago-Olivares. The renovation resulted to a more elegant yet homey atmosphere.

Accessibility

Waterfront Pavilion Hotel is easy to get to; it’s just a 30-minute drive from NAIA, very near shopping malls, Intramuros, Manila Ocean Park, old churches, museums and Rizal Park. You can also just take one jeepney ride and you can get to Chinatown where you can feast on delectable Chinese food from dimsum to roasted Peking Duck.

Rooms

The Manila Pavilion Waterfront Hotel and Casino Manila (hotel reviews) has more than 400 fully-furnished and stunningly designed rooms (deluxe, deluxe premium, en-suite, premier room and suite, ambassador room and suite, executive suite and presidential suite. All rooms have been well-thought of with only the happiness of the guests in mind.

Amenities

The Manila Pavilion Waterfront Hotel has its very own chapel and its open 24/7. They also have a spa, a fitness gym and an outdoor pool and true to its name, there is a casino inside the hotel where everybody can enjoy a game or two while drinking cocktails.
